Today's 5 Stock Ideas:
- BlackBerry (BB) - Shares were up 5% Wednesday morning following news automaker Volvo selected the company's QNX platform for its dynamic software platform.
- SOS (SOS) - The stock was up 30% in pre-market action following circulation of the stock as a non-WallStreetBets Reddit name.
- Omnichannel Acquisition (OCA) - Company CEO, Gary Vaynerchuk, will appear on Benzinga's "SPACs Attack" YouTube show at 11:15 a.m. EDT Wednesday. The last time Gary was on the show, at the beginning of March, he discussed his investment in Coinbase (COIN).
- Trimble (TRMB) - ARK Invest's Cathie Wood purchased about $63 million in the stock on Tuesday.
- Kandi Technologies (KNDI) - Shares spiked about 2% in late-day trade Tuesday following a report from electric vehicle publication, Electrek, the US is rumored to raise its electric vehicle auto incentive to $10,000.
